Hey man, just a quick tip for you. Anytime you are loading a trailer you should always try to center the load over the axles of the trailer. Putting the weight to far forward like you have transfers alot of tounge weight onto the tow veichle....if you had not pulled the silver 4runner up on the trailer as far it would not have squatted the rear of your tow rig near as much and been safer. You are transferring weight to the rear of the red 4runner, taking pressure off the front tires & limiting you braking & steering effectiveness.

Here's my 91 sr5 3.0.. Bought it about a year ago from the original owner with 100k on the clock. He drove it 12 miles a day to and from work, 5 days a week and only used the 4x4 when it snowed (and here and there to keep it in good shape). Had the head gasket recall done at 75,000. Not a scratch or dent on the thing and the interior is perfect except for a wear spot on the drivers seat. He ordered it with all options except AC as it doesn't get that hot around here. Plenty of life and power left in this engine.
I plan to do an AAL and new tires but leave it pretty much like that. it's my DD and wont see much action other than forest service roads and some snow.
